Value of Microsoft Accessibility in Your Organization
Mid to large organizations may have hundreds to countless desktop computers. Each desktop has standard software application that permits team to complete computer jobs without the treatment of the company's IT division. This uses the main tenet of desktop computer computer: equipping individuals to boost efficiency as well as lower costs through decentralized computer.
As the world's most popular desktop computer data source, Microsoft Access is made use of in nearly all companies that make use of Microsoft Windows. As users become a lot more proficient in the operation of these applications, they begin to identify services to company tasks that they themselves can implement. The all-natural advancement of this procedure is that spread sheets and also data sources are created and also kept by end-users to handle their day-to-day jobs.
This dynamic permits both performance as well as agility as customers are equipped to fix company troubles without the treatment of their organization's Infotech facilities. Microsoft Accessibility suits this room by offering a desktop computer data source environment where end-users can promptly develop data source applications with tables, queries, kinds and also reports. Accessibility is perfect for low-cost single customer or workgroup database applications.
However this power has a price. As even more users utilize Microsoft Accessibility to handle their work, concerns of data safety, integrity, maintainability, scalability and administration come to be acute. The people who developed these solutions are seldom trained to be database professionals, designers or system managers. As databases outgrow the capabilities of the original author, they have to relocate right into an extra durable setting.
While some people consider this a reason end-users should not ever before make use of Microsoft Accessibility, we consider this to be the exemption as opposed to the rule. Most Microsoft Accessibility data sources are created by end-users and also never ever have to graduate to the following degree. Implementing a method to create every end-user data source "skillfully" would certainly be a big waste of resources.
For the rare Microsoft Accessibility databases that are so successful that they should advance, SQL Server uses the next natural progression. Without shedding the existing investment in the application (table designs, data, queries, kinds, reports, macros and components), information can be transferred to SQL Server and the Access database connected to it. When in SQL Server, other systems such as Visual Studio.NET can be made use of to produce Windows, web and/or mobile options. The Access database application may be completely replaced or a hybrid option may be developed.
For additional information, read our paper Microsoft Access within a Company's General Data source Strategy.
Microsoft Accessibility as well as SQL Database Architectures
Microsoft Accessibility is the premier desktop data source item offered for Microsoft Windows. Considering that its intro in 1992, Gain access to has actually offered a functional platform for novices and also power individuals to develop single-user as well as tiny workgroup database applications.
Microsoft Gain access to has actually delighted in great success since it spearheaded the concept of stepping individuals via a difficult task with using Wizards. This, in addition to an instinctive query designer, one of the very best desktop computer coverage devices and the inclusion of macros as well as a coding atmosphere, all add to making Access the very best selection for desktop computer data source development.
Since Access is developed to be easy to use as well as friendly, it was never ever planned as a system for the most reliable and robust applications. In general, upsizing should occur when these attributes end up being important for the application. The good news is, the adaptability of Accessibility enables you to upsize to SQL Server in a range of methods, from a quick cost-effective, data-moving scenario to complete application redesign.
Accessibility supplies a rich variety of information designs that enable it to handle data in a variety of means. When taking into consideration an upsizing job, it is necessary to comprehend the variety of means Gain access to may be set up to use its native Jet database format and SQL Server in both solitary as well as multi-user environments.
Accessibility and the Jet Engine
Microsoft Accessibility has its very own data source engine-- the Microsoft Jet Data source Engine (also called the ACE with Accessibility 2007's introduction of the ACCDB layout). Jet was developed from the starting to sustain single user and also multiuser data sharing on a local area network. Databases have a maximum dimension of 2 GB, although an Access database could link to various other databases using linked tables and numerous backend data sources to workaround the 2 GB limit.
But Accessibility is greater than a data source engine. It is also an application development atmosphere that permits users to create queries, develop types as well as reports, and create macros as well as Aesthetic Fundamental for Applications (VBA) module code to automate an application. In its default setup, Gain access to utilizes Jet inside to keep its style things such as types, reports, macros, and modules as well as makes use of Jet to keep all table information.
One of the key benefits of Gain access to upsizing is that you can upgrade your application to remain to use its types, records, macros as well as components, and also change the Jet Engine with SQL Server. This permits the most effective of both globes: the convenience of use of Accessibility with the integrity as well as protection of SQL Server.
Before you try to transform an Access database to SQL Server, see to it you recognize:
Which applications belong in Microsoft Accessibility vs. SQL Server? Not every data source must be modified.
The reasons for upsizing your database. Make sure SQL Server gives you what you look for.
The tradeoffs for doing so. There are pluses and also minuses depending upon exactly what you're aiming to enhance. Ensure you are not migrating to SQL Server only for efficiency factors.
In many cases, efficiency decreases when an application is upsized, especially for reasonably little databases (under 200 MEGABYTES).
Some efficiency issues are unconnected to the backend database. Poorly made inquiries and table design will not be taken care of by upsizing. Microsoft Access tables use some attributes that SQL Server tables do not such as an automated refresh when the information changes. SQL Server needs Discover More a specific requery.
Alternatives for Moving Microsoft Accessibility to SQL Server
There are several choices for hosting SQL Server databases:
A neighborhood instance of SQL Express, which is a complimentary version of SQL Server can be set up on each customer's device
A common SQL Server data source on your network
A cloud host such as SQL Azure. Cloud hosts have security that limit which IP addresses could recover information, so set IP addresses and/or VPN is necessary.
There are many means to upsize your Microsoft Accessibility databases to SQL Server:
Relocate the data to SQL Server and link to it from your Access database while maintaining the existing Access application.
Modifications could be had to support SQL Server questions and also distinctions from Accessibility data sources.
Convert an Accessibility MDB database to a Gain access to Data Task (ADP) that attaches straight to a SQL Server database.
Considering that ADPs were deprecated in Gain access to 2013, we do not suggest this choice.
Usage Microsoft Access with MS Azure.
With Office365, your information is published into a SQL Server data source organized by SQL Azure with an Access Web front end
Proper for basic watching and also editing of information throughout the web
Regrettably, Gain Access To Web Applications do not have the personalization includes similar to VBA in Gain access to desktop computer solutions
Move the entire application to the.NET Framework, ASP.NET, as well as SQL Server system, or recreate it on SharePoint.
A hybrid solution that puts the information in SQL Server with one more front-end plus a Gain access to front-end data source.
SQL Server can be the standard variation organized on Going Here a venture top quality web server or a totally free SQL Server Express edition installed on your COMPUTER
Database Difficulties in an Organization
Every organization needs to get rid of database obstacles to meet their mission. These challenges consist of:
• Taking full advantage of return on investment
• Taking care of human resources
• Quick implementation
• Adaptability as well as maintainability
• Scalability (secondary).
Making Best Use Of Return on Investment.
Making best use of return on investment is extra vital compared to ever. Monitoring demands substantial results for the costly investments in data source application development. Many data source growth efforts fail to generate the outcomes they assure. Picking the ideal technology and also technique for each degree in an organization is critical to making the most of return on investment. This suggests picking the very best complete return, which doesn't indicate choosing the least pricey initial service. This is commonly the most crucial choice a chief info policeman (CIO) or chief innovation policeman (CTO) makes.
Handling Human Resources.
Handling people to customize modern technology is testing. The even more complicated the technology or application, the fewer people are certified to handle it, and also the more expensive they are to hire. Turnover is constantly a concern, and also having the right criteria is critical to effectively sustaining tradition applications. Training as well as staying on par with modern technology are likewise challenging.
Producing data source applications swiftly is necessary, not only for decreasing prices, but also for reacting to internal or client demands. The capacity to produce applications quickly gives a considerable competitive advantage.
The IT supervisor is accountable for providing choices as well as making tradeoffs to sustain the business demands of the organization. By using various innovations, you can use organisation choice makers selections, such as a 60 percent service in 3 months, a 90 percent remedy in twelve months, or a 99 percent service in twenty-four months. (Instead of months, maybe bucks.) Occasionally, time to market is most crucial, other times it could be expense, and also various other times features or safety are most important. Demands alter quickly as well as are unforeseeable. We stay in a "good enough" as opposed to a best world, so understanding how you can deliver "good enough" solutions rapidly offers you and your company an one-upmanship.
Flexibility as well as Maintainability.
Despite having the most effective system style, by the time multiple month development efforts are completed, needs modification. Versions comply with variations, as well as a system that's made to be flexible and able to accommodate adjustment could indicate the distinction Discover More Here in between success and failing for the users' jobs.
Solution should be developed to manage the expected information and even more. Yet many systems are never ever completed, are thrown out soon, or alter a lot in time that the initial evaluations are wrong. Scalability is important, but often lesser than a fast solution. If the application effectively sustains growth, scalability can be added later when it's economically warranted.